TSMC’s High-NA Plan Gives ASML a Catalyst, but Investors Face Two Different Timelines

ASML Holding N.V. (NASDAQ:ASML) and Taiwan Semiconductor Manufacturing Company Limited (NYSE:TSM) have given investors a clearer view of their next manufacturing transition. The important distinction is when each company might earn a return.

Their September 8 announcement says TSMC intends to introduce ASML’s High-NA extreme ultraviolet technology into high-volume advanced-node manufacturing starting in 2030. A separate initiative targets a larger photomask pilot line in 2031 and corresponding lithography systems for advanced production in 2033.

Those dates describe successive stages, not a single launch delayed until 2033. Initial production would use existing six-inch masks; the later transition would introduce twelve-inch masks.

Equipment revenue comes before manufacturing proof

For ASML, a major customer’s stated adoption plan strengthens the long-term demand case. More advanced AI chips require increasingly complex manufacturing, and TSMC expects more layers to need High-NA technology as nodes progress.

The announcement does not provide an order value, shipment schedule or earnings contribution. Investors should therefore treat the roadmap as improved visibility into a possible market, rather than completed equipment sales.

TSMC faces a different calculation. New equipment must produce chips economically enough to support customer demand and justify the capital committed. A manufacturing advantage can strengthen its foundry franchise, but the investment only creates value if yield, utilization and pricing support an acceptable return.

Larger masks are intended to improve productivity, reduce costs and remove stitching constraints. These are expected benefits of the future transition, not measured savings already appearing in either company’s results.

A shared roadmap still leaves different risks

The supplier can benefit when customers buy and accept equipment; the manufacturer must then turn that capacity into profitable output. That timing difference makes the same technology milestone relevant to both stocks without making their earnings exposure identical.

Execution also reaches beyond two companies. Mask suppliers and other partners must deliver a functioning ecosystem. A promising scanner alone cannot establish an economical production process, while slower customer adoption could defer ASML’s opportunity.

Historical ownership provides context. Insider Monkey’s tracked worksheet sample counted 140 ASML holders in Q2 2026 versus 133 in Q1, and 249 TSMC holders versus 234. Ken Fisher’s firm reported positions in both companies. These holdings precede September’s announcement.

The August 14 short-interest snapshot was also modest: 0.34% of ASML’s float and 0.59% of TSMC’s.

For ASML Holding N.V., watch the conversion of adoption plans into orders and deliveries. For Taiwan Semiconductor Manufacturing Company Limited, watch manufacturing economics. The roadmap supports both investment cases, but it does not settle either one.
